QWhat are the licensing requirements for private security companies operating in Slater, Colorado?
In Slater, Colorado, private security companies must be licensed through the Colorado Department of Regulatory Agencies (DORA), Division of Professions and Occupations, specifically under the Private Security Services Program. Security guards must complete 16 hours of training, pass a background check, and obtain a license. Companies themselves need a business license from the state. QHow much does private security typically cost in Slater, Colorado?
In Slater, private security costs are generally lower than in urban areas due to the rural location and lower cost of living. Unarmed security guards typically range from $20-$30 per hour, while armed guards may cost $30-$45 per hour. Mobile patrol services for large properties or ranches might be priced at $40-$60 per visit. For long-term contracts or agricultural property monitoring, monthly rates can range from $1,500 to $4,000 depending on the property size and required services. These prices are estimates and can vary based on specific needs and company pricing structures.
